Las Ramblas
The most famous street of Barcelona and the main street of the old city. Actually it calls Las Ramblas because it consist of five short streets named by named for their intended purpose. You will see a lot of flowers, theaters, work of Joan Miro and people from all over the world.

Casa Batllo
Work of Antonio Gaudi. Who already is a brand of Catalonia. He made this house for Josep Batlló y Casanovas, successful businessman of that period. The building what now look like a dragon was reformed by Gaudi in 1906. And it´s open for visits just from 1995.
Manzana de la Discordia
The Bone of Contention. Casa Batlio is forming part of this street with a different buildings made in modernist style. It consist of Casa Amatller (Josep Puig i Cadafalch, he was a main architect of Barcelona in the beginning of XX century), Casa Lleó Morera (Lluís Domènech i Montaner, he was a teacher of Gaudí), Casa Mulleras (Enric Sagnier), Casa Josefina Bonet (Marcel-li Coquillat).

Monument a Mossen Jacint Verdaguer
Jacint Verdaguer was called "Prince of Catalan poets". He was one of the most important figures in Catalan literature and culture. This monument was finished in 1924. The ceremony speech was in Spanish so followers of Verdaguer ignored the opening.
Basilica de la Sagrada Familia
Sagrada Familia provides us with the greatest idea of what Gaudi wanted to build for God. And still to this day, the people and government of Catalonia support his intent. Last news say that it will be finished in 2026. The idea to build this cathedral comes from Josep Maria Bocabella i Verdaguer, who had a religious books store. And Gaudi was not the firs architect of the project. When the building will be finished it will have 3 facades, 18 towers full of allegory of bible stories.
